|
Sure. This would be the bare minimum implementation:
[Designer("System.Windows.Forms.Design.TabPageDesigner, System.Design, Version=2.0.0.0, Culture=neutral, PublicKeyToken=b03f5f7f11d50a3a")]
public class CustomTabPage : TabPage
{
} The only issue is that you can't add these tab pages to the TabControl at design time since the TabControl class doesn't know anything about them. You can add the tab pages normally and then go into the designer code and change them by hand. (Even though the designer code is autogenerated, this change won't be lost the next time it is generated.)
If you want to be able to add them at design time, you would need to do some more work and create a custom TabControl derived class that knows how to add these controls instead of the normal TabControl .
|
|
|
|
|
Nah, that didn't work, but thanks.
Could you show an example of where you've had something like this work?
|
|
|
|
|
PIEBALDconsult wrote: Nah, that didn't work, but thanks.
What didn't work about that? I pulled that from a simple test app I created and it seemed to work there.
|
|
|
|
|
Didn't provide the Designer like that of a Form or UserControl. But I'm going to look at what you sent further, now that I've gotten some sleep.
|
|
|
|
|
Well, for one thing I needed to add a reference to System.Design
I think I actually need to use System.Windows.Forms.Design.ParentControlDesigner , and I've tried, but still no joy.
|
|
|
|
|
Or maybe it's System.Windows.Forms.Design.UserControlDocumentDesigner , still trying...
|
|
|
|
|
Hmmm...what is the behavior you are expecting and/or not seeing? When I added the System.Windows.Forms.Design.TabPageDesigner it gave me the same design time experience as the normal TabPage does.
|
|
|
|
|
Hi all, we are currently developing with the .net 2.0 version because we were asked to ensure compatibility with mono. Since Mono is implementing some of the features of the 3.0 version we thought to give to 3.0 a look, but we aren't sure what to install. Do we need a new version of the sdk? We Have found the redistributable package download, but it seems that the sdk is a separate file of more than 1 GB. Does it really require all that memory, given that we already have the 2.0 installed, or is there somewhere an update file?
Thank you!
|
|
|
|
|
It's not memory, just HDD space.
Christian Graus - Microsoft MVP - C++
"I am working on a project that will convert a FORTRAN code to corresponding C++ code.I am not aware of FORTRAN syntax" ( spotted in the C++/CLI forum )
|
|
|
|
|
Err... thank you, perhaps my english is worse than I thought, I do know of course that it refers to the size of the file, not the memory required.
What I meant, is that we don't really need 3.0, we just want to give it a look, and we would be very unpleased to saturate the (currently limited) band of our temporary internet connection for 5+ hours just to discover that it is the wrong file.
So my question is:
Assuming that we have already the 2.0 sdk and runtime installed and running, which files do we need in order to be able to compile and execute a 3.0 program? And to be even more precise, we are working with c#.
Thank you again
|
|
|
|
|
|
|
|
We really need a "Mr Nice Guy" status just for you. You really do have the nicest approach on the site. Oh how I wish I was like you instead of the cynical, sarcastic me. Nah - cynical and sarcastic is so much fun.
Deja View - the feeling that you've seen this post before.
|
|
|
|
|
Pete O`Hanlon wrote: We really need a "Mr Nice Guy" status just for you.
LOL.
Pete O`Hanlon wrote: You really do have the nicest approach on the site.
Thanks. I think. I guess I take that approach because I've seen so many people take the other path and not get anywhere in trying to get through to some of these people. I figured I would try a different tack and see if it works. I guess it has...at least so far.
Pete O`Hanlon wrote: Oh how I wish I was like you instead of the cynical, sarcastic me. Nah - cynical and sarcastic is so much fun.
Oh believe me...I can be super cynical and sarcastic if I need to be. I don't know if you remember the The code monkeys are invading![^] posts from a few months ago, but it was spurred because of one of my blog posts...which was a rant about the level of stupid questions appearing here on CP. I've posted a few such rants on my blog over the past year or so.
|
|
|
|
|
Scott Dorman wrote: I don't know if you remember the The code monkeys are invading![^] posts
I remember it well - I also remember people getting hot under the collar about what was basically a very valid point.
Deja View - the feeling that you've seen this post before.
|
|
|
|
|
Pete O`Hanlon wrote: I remember it well - I also remember people getting hot under the collar about what was basically a very valid point.
Yes, it did get people a bit hot under the collar...oh well...it was just a rant on a valid trend I was seeing (and still am).
|
|
|
|
|
cignox1 wrote: we are currently developing with the .net 2.0 version because we were asked to ensure compatibility with mono.
That's just a bit of a ridiculous requirement since Mono hasn't implemented all of the .NET 2.0 classes yet.
|
|
|
|
|
Hi,
Currently I'm developing a project with ASP.NET (C# code behind), and I m expecting a bug when I try to upload a file with more than 4Mb.After making some research I find out that 4Mb is the standard file size that can be uploaded.
We can change this limit in the web.config but it s not really what I'm expected.
I'm doing a check on the server side, but this means that the file is already in the cache.
The fact is, even if I check the size limit on the server side , the error is through before.
So how can I display my own error message ?
In advance thanks
|
|
|
|
|
The actual limit is 3mb which is why you are getting the error. There are two web.config settings you need to worry about:
<httpRuntime executionTimeout="300" maxRequestLength="15360"/>
The maxRequestLength in this example has been set to 15mb. The other setting you need to be worried about is the executionTimeout which is this example is set to 300 seconds which is 5 minutes. If these two setting are set correctly you should have no issues upload files to your system.
Hope that helps.
Ben
-- modified at 15:06 Tuesday 2nd October, 2007
|
|
|
|
|
You may want to repost your example. You forgot to check the "Ignore HTML tags in this message" box before you hit the "Post Message" button. Your example isn't visible.
|
|
|
|
|
Thanks Dave,
Usually I am the once asking the people posting a question to do that. It is sort of funny because when I posted my reply I thought to myself, make sure you check that box. Of course, then I forgot to. Anyway, thanks for letting me know.
Ben
|
|
|
|
|
Hi All,
We need small help regarding audio files processing. For
reducing the noise in audio files, is there any API or DLLs available
in .net means in either C# or in VB.
Please help us if anybody knows this problem.
Padma.B
|
|
|
|
|
I don't know of such a lib, but if you feel like to take the dirty way, then you may try with the FFT (fast fourier transform). Well, it is not trivial to use it to process a sound, and I'm not an expert myself, but using FFT (you should be able to find it somewhere) you can transform the sound in a sequence of amplitudes, Each element of the sequence defines the amplitude of the sound at a given frequency. You can sample the noise in a short time of silence (where only noise is recorded) and then use the FFT to get the frequencies that compose the noise. This should let you remove (or better yet reduce) those frequencies from your original sound, thus reducing the noise in it.
Hope this helps
Alessandro
|
|
|
|
|
I look over some projects in CodeProject about creating FolderViev, FolderTreeView etc. in An "Explorer Style" and I see everywhere are used shell operations. Is that the only one way to do controls like this? Isn't there any simple method? Does C# and .Net provide owns classes and methods including shell instructions, or I have to write it always myself? And I have one more questions: Is there any reason that everybody use shell to manage folders instead of using such C# classes like Directory[info], File[info] and others classes included in System.IO namespace?
|
|
|
|